Why work towards a more equal, resilient, and innovative society?
Equality and gender equality are not just matters of fairness – they are fundamental prerequisites for achieving social, economic, and environmental sustainability.
Research shows that societies investing in these areas achieve stronger economic results, better social cohesion, and are better equipped to handle crises and increase their innovation capacity.
When people have the opportunity to participate in society on equal terms, we become more resilient in facing today's complex challenges. In addition to being a goal and value in itself, extensive international research points to equality and social sustainability as crucial factors for both resilience and innovation, in both large societies and small organizations. Equality is simply a prerequisite for resilience and innovation to be consistently sustainable and impactful. The conditions equality brings include enhanced trust and confidence between people and the inclusion of more perspectives to solve old and new challenges with unforeseen opportunities.
